Fallacies of Relevance
Fallacies of Relevance are those fallacies in which the premises are
irrelevant to the conclusion.
I. Appeal to Emotion (Argumentum Ad Populum)
A fallacy in which the argument relies on emotion rather than reason
A. Example 1
Salamat Kaibigan: Privilege Speech of Senator Ramon Bong Revilla,
Jr. (June 9, 2014)
Lead this country not with hatred but with love. Lead the country towards unity
and not partisanship. Push our nations interest and not political agenda.
Bibihira ang nabibigyan ng pagkakataon na maging pangulo. At mapalad ka
Pangulong Aquino1
B. Explanation
The premise is directed to the President: [l]ead this country not with hatred
but with love. Lead the country towards unity and not partisanship. Push our
nations interest and not political agenda. Bibihira ang nabibigyan ng
pagkakataon na maging pangulo, while the conclusion is [a]t mapalad ka
Pangulong Aquino.
The speaker tries to support his conclusion that Aquino is lucky for being the
President elect since only few men one every six years do get the
Malacanang seat. However, with the use of expressive language, the speaker
takes the reader away from the reality of how one wins the Presidency. Far from
luck, winning an election comes down to ones resources, hard work, and
popularity among many others.

C. Example 2
Senator Miriam Defensor Santiagos speech on the pork barrel scam
before the PH Psychiatric Association (January 21, 2014)
The public has already accepted that if there is pork barrel given to the
Congressmen and Senators, they will surely steal the 10 percent. Thats why, if
you are called ten percent-er, its really embarrassing but the public has
accepted it anyways. After all, everyone [politicians] receives the 10 percent!
D. Explanation
The premise of the argument is [t]he public has already accepted that if there
is pork barrel given to the Congressmen and Senators, they will surely steal the
10 percent. Thats why, if you are called ten percent-er, its really embarrassing
but the public has accepted it anyways, while the conclusion is [a]fter all,
everyone receives the 10 percent!
The speaker, in the hopes of supporting her claim that all politicians receive a
ten percent kickback from their pork barrels, appeal to the multitude by making
it seem like it is an accepted fact just because a lot of people believe in it. This is
an example of appealing to the populace.

Fallacies of Presumption
Fallacies in which the conclusion depends on a tacit assumption that is
dubious, unwarranted, or false
I. Fallacy of Accident
A fallacy in which a generalization is wrongly applied to a particular case.
A. Example
Farce by Conrado de Quiros (March 17, 2014)
If Luy and Tuason and Cunanan have been forced or threatened into
testifying, then surely it would be the easiest thing to show them up. Fearful
people tend to be tremendously anxious and nervous and trip on their
answers.11
B. Explanation
In this example Luy and Tuason were improperly generalized as fearful people
because the fact that they gave in to the threat of prosecution and chose to
testify to avoid does not necessarily imply that the are fearful people. Moreover,
being anxious and nervous when testifying under oath is normal especially given
the circumstances of their case wherein theres is a dilemma between ratting out
powerful individuals and facing serious criminal charges.

Fallacies of Ambiguity
Fallacies caused by a shift or confusion of meanings within an argument,
also known as sophisms
I. Fallacy of Equivocation
A fallacy in which two or more meanings of a word or phrase are used in different parts of an
argument.
A. Example
GMA News Coverage on Miriam Santiago Speech August 28, 2013
Banat Laban Sa Pork Barrel at Kapwa Pulitiko
The brain of a Filipino politician has two sides, the left has nothing right in it.
The right side has nothing left in it. 14
B. Explanation:
Senator Miriam Santiago in this speech took jabs at her fellow politicians. In her
usual humorous manner she referred to the left and right sides of the brain.
This statement is a fallacy of equivocation wherein the words left and right were
both used to express two different meanings respectively. (1) Left as in referring
to a side and direction and (2) left meaning to go away or abandon. (1) Right as
in referring to a side and direction and (2) right meaning correct or morally
good.

V. Fallacy of Division
A fallacy in which a mistaken inference is drawn from the attributes of a whole to the attributes
of the parts of the whole.
A. Example
Is Miriam the only real senator left? by Rigoberto Tiglao (November
26, 2014)
History will condemn the 16th Congress as the worst ever Aquinos rubber
stamp, especially for the 2015 budget. But what happened to the senators we
would have thought had the brains, independence and courage to protest this
ignominy that is the 2015 budget the economist Ralph Recto, the level-headed
Sergio Osmena, the once swashbuckling Greg Honasan, the business-minded
Cynthia Villar and the mestiza Grace Poe? Nancy Binay should be told she is
not in the senate just to defend her father while Ferdinand Marcos Jr. should
remember his father was a studious, bold opposition leader at least for a time.
Are Loren Legarda and Pia Cayetano still senators? 18

B. Explanation
In the fallacy of division, an argument falsely assumes that what is true of a
whole must also be true of its parts. The example gives the premise that the 16th
Congress is a terrible one and concludes therefore that the individual
congressmen and congresswomen in the 16th Congress are terrible congressmen
and congresswomen. It is a fallacy of division because it is not necessarily true
that if the Congress as a collective is terrible that the individuals that make up
the Congress are each terrible at their jobs.
